A Man Traveled 1,500 Miles To Adopt A Dog, And It Was Love At First Sight

You’ll go to great efforts to display your love for your specific someone if it’s love at first sight. Being in love is a wonderful experience, which is why people seek ways to communicate their feelings to the person they love.

That similar feeling might be felt by potential dog owners for the dog they desire to adopt. These people are dedicated to saving and adopting dogs in various locations. They even go to distant nations in order to bring a dog back to their homeland should they choose the animal to be a part of their home.

A man’s story is one-of-a-kind. He had just no idea how he was really going to get a dog back to his home. He wanted to adopt this specific dog from a town 1,500 kilometers away from where he lived.

Joel Carpenter of Maine was looking for a dog to adopt on a prominent dog adoption website. While browsing, he fell in love with Sadie, a Collie-Husky mix, after seeing her on the said website. The distance, on the other hand, was a problem that Joel was facing with regard to adopting Sadie. See, Sadie lived in Minnesota, which is almost 1,500 miles away from Maine.

Joel was still determined to bring Sadie to Maine, despite the distance. So he purchased a $300 one-way plane ticket to Minnesota in order to formally adopt the dog.

The man now faced a new obstacle after adopting Sadie: he lacked the finances to return to Maine. Joel was determined to walk with Sadie from Minnesota to Maine if that was what it took to bring the dog back home.

Thankfully, Joel’s story piqued the eye of a news organization. They happily invited Joel for an interview and then decided to purchase a plane ticket for him to return home.

It’s a touching story because Joel didn’t think twice about adopting Sadie despite the distance. Joel surely was determined to provide a nice life for Sadie and that is what he did.
